CSE gives 5% dividend for FY 2019-20

Photo: Courtesy

Chittagong Stock Exchange Limited has approved five percent dividend for its shareholders for the 2019-20 fiscal year.

The decision was taken during the 25th Annual General Meeting (AGM) of the CSE held at its conference hall this afternoon.

Asif Ibrahim, chairman of the CSE conducted the AGM that was held virtually in line with the directives of Bangladesh Securities and Exchange Commission (BSEC), said a press release.

The shareholders also elected Md Siddiqur Rahman, managing director of S. R. Capital Limited and Mohammed Mohiuddin, FCMA, managing director of Island Securities Limited as directors of the Board of the CSE.
